Remember that the set of natural numbers with the number 0,  is obtained by adding 1 to 1 repeatedly to any level. That is to say 1, 1+1, 1+1+1, 1+1+1+1,... Giving 1,2,3,4,... You now know how the set of natural numbers is built. Many others are obtained using different approaches. Below are some of these patterns:


1. Arithmetic Sequences: Ever noticed how some number sequences increase or decrease by a constant difference? That's an arithmetic sequence! The formula to remember is nth term = first term + (n-1)  common difference.


2. Geometric Sequences: In a geometric sequence, each term is multiplied by a constant to get the next term. The formula here is nth term = first term * (common ratio)^(n-1).


3. The Fibonacci Sequence: This one's a crowd favorite! Each number in the sequence is the sum of the two preceding ones. So it starts like this: 0, 1, 1, 2, 3, 5, 8...


4. Quadratic Patterns: These patterns form parabolic curves when graphed. The second difference in the sequence is constant.


5. Fractal Patterns: Remember the Sierpinski triangle or the Mandelbrot set? These are examples of fractal patterns in algebra, where a simple pattern repeats infinitely at every scale.

Why should you examine these patterns?


1. See Math in a New Light: Recognizing patterns helps you appreciate the beauty and symmetry in math.

2. Enhance Understanding: Patterns provide insights into how numbers are interconnected, deepening your understanding of algebra.

3. Boost Problem-Solving Skills: Recognizing patterns can help you solve complex problems more easily.

4. Apply Math in Real Life: Many real-world phenomena follow mathematical patterns. Recognizing them can help you in fields like physics, economics, and computer science.
